Free agency is dragging on, and still no home for Shayne Graham. I’m surprised that no team has yet signed him to a deal.
Graham isn’t the greatest kicker in the world, but he’s accurate. Only five have hit a better percentage of field goals over the last five years. And Graham is only 32, which is very good age for a kicker (the young ones tend to be erratic, while the old ones start losing range).
Plenty of teams out there still need a kicker. Ravens, Cowboys, Jets, Falcons, Bengals and Falcons are all solid playoff contenders, and he might help any of those teams.
FIELD GOAL ACCURACY, 2007-2009
Kickers with 50-plus attempts.
FG FGA Pct
77 87 88.5 Jeff Reed
83 94 88.3 Nate Kaeding
91 104 87.5 Rob Bironas
83 95 87.4 Stephen Gostkowski
75 86 87.2 Ryan Longwell
75 86 87.2 Shayne Graham
81 93 87.1 Robbie Gould
60 69 87.0 John Carney
46 53 86.8 Dan Carpenter
63 73 86.3 Joe Nedney
75 87 86.2 Jay Feely
74 86 86.0 John Kasay
73 85 85.9 Phil Dawson
51 60 85.0 Lawrence Tynes
68 81 84.0 Jason Elam
82 98 83.7 Rian Lindell
71 85 83.5 Jason Hanson
78 94 83.0 Josh Brown
63 76 82.9 Matt Stover
58 70 82.9 Olindo Mare
67 81 82.7 Matt Bryant
62 75 82.7 Neil Rackers
89 109 81.7 David Akers
73 91 80.2 Sebastian Janikowski
75 94 79.8 Kris Brown
50 63 79.4 Adam Vinatieri
64 81 79.0 Nick Folk
75 95 78.9 Shaun Suisham
85 109 78.0 Mason Crosby
56 73 76.7 Matt Prater
49 66 74.2 Josh Scobee
